The nose is fruity and concentrated and offers a certain power and a hint of kirsch and licorice. It reveals notes of roasted cherry, concentrated wild blackberry and small notes of small red berries with kirsch associated with touches of balsamic, as well as fine hints of bay laurel, lilac and a discreet hint of nutmeg. The palate is fruity and offers juiciness, a certain richness of fruit, concentration, darkness and depth. In mouth this wine expresses notes of concentrated cassis, elegant-roasted cherry and small notes of small juicy/concentrated roasted fruits associated with touches of licorice stick, tobacco, as well as small hints of cardamom, mocha, balsamic and rosemary in the background. Mellow tannins. Toasted hazelnut note. Good length.
